Job Description

The items listed below identify the conditions and expectations of providers position. This list is not all inclusive. However, it does reflect the basic framework and duties for the position.

1. Hours of operation to be a total of 72 hours per pay period with each shift from 8 a.m. through 9:00 p.m. (urgent care clinic session), noting that the 72-hour shifts are excluding the months of November and December annually, and understanding that business needs must be met first, unless otherwise specified.

2. Extra shifts are available and paid at the base salary equivalent hourly rate.

3. Provider to arrive punctually for each outpatient office clinic shift.

4. All medical records and all administrative records shall be completed within twenty-four (24) hours of the provision of service.

5. All authorization referrals to be completed at the time of the patient visit.

6. All patient call backs regarding prescription refills, laboratory results, etc., to be completed by the end of each day on which such information is received.

7. Supervision required: A physician assistant (PA) may be assigned to you for supervision by way of a Delegation of Service Agreement between supervising physician and PA. The PA must be supervised in accordance with the written supervisor guidelines required by Section 3502 of the Business and Professions Code and Section 1399.545 of the Physician Assistant Regulations.

8. Supervision required: A nurse practitioner (NP) may be assigned to you for supervision by way of a Delegation of Service Agreement between supervising physician and NP. The NP must be supervised in accordance with the written supervisor guidelines required by Section 2725 of the Business and Professions Code and the guidelines of the Nurse Practice Act (NPA)

9. Provider to perform full scope of his/her subspecialty skill, including, but not limited to, routine office gynecology, dermatology (including punch biopsies), etc.

10. Provider to promote the goals of BFMG to support staff and to be a role model of the attributes of personalized patient care and quality medicine.

11. Provider to cooperate fully with superiors and coworkers in accomplishing the goals, services, and business needs of BFMG.

12. Provider will strive to achieve a five (5) STAR rating for Medicare and a four (4) STAR rating for HEDIS measures.

13. Additional duties as required.
